How To make Angel Hair Pasta Withfresh Tomato& Basil Sauce
7 md Tomatoes, skinned & coarsely
-- chopped 8 oz Angel hair pasta
3 tb Olive oil
1/3 c Basil, chopped
1/4 c Parsley, chopped
2 ea Scallions, minced
1/3 c Green olives, sliced
Salt & pepper
Cook & drain the pasta. In a serving bowl, combine the pasta with the tomatoes & remaining ingredients. Toss & serve immediately. NOTE: In place of green olives, use black olives, same amount.

Angel Hair al Pomodoro - Quick Light & Delicious Tomato Sauce with Pasta Recipe
Enjoy this quick light & delicious tomato sauce with pasta recipe. This video fully illustrates a simple recipe that is very easy to prepare. Angel Hair Al Pomodoro sauce is made from scratch and consists of only the freshest of ingredients, such as tomato, EVOO, grated parmesan, fresh basil onion and garlic. I like to use fresh ripe Roma tomatoes and extra virgin olive oil (EVOO) for this dish. The EVOO gives the tomato sauce a distinctive flavor and is what makes this dish a heart-healthy alternative. All these fresh ingredients coming together makes a fantastic light and flavorful tomato sauce. What I also like about this dish is that it only takes a few ingredients and about 15 minutes from start to finish. It’s quick and will satisfy your craving for pasta.
This recipe was one of my father’s (Angelo) favorites. He was born in Naples, Italy and came here to America when he was 24 years old and opened his first Italian restaurant in Brooklyn, NY.

Capellini with Tomatoes and Basil
RECIPE COURTESY OF INA GARTEN
Level: Easy
Yield: 6 servings
Ingredients
Kosher salt
1/2 cup good olive oil, plus extra for the pot
2 tablespoons minced garlic (6 cloves)
4 pints small cherry tomatoes or grape tomoatoes
18 large basil leaves, julienned
2 tablespoons chopped fresh curly parsley
2 teaspoons chopped fresh thyme leaves
1 teaspoon freshly ground black pepper
1/2 teaspoon crushed red pepper flakes
3/4 pound dried capellini or angel hair pasta
1 1/2 cups freshly grated Parmesan cheese
Extra chopped basil and grated Parmesan, for serving
Directions
Bring a large pot of water to a boil and add 2 tablespoons of salt and a splash of oil to the pot.
Meanwhile, heat the 1/2 cup of olive oil in a large (12-inch) saute pan. Add the garlic to the oil and cook over medium heat for 30 seconds. Add the tomatoes, basil, parsley, thyme, 2 teaspoons salt, the pepper, and red pepper flakes. Reduce the heat to medium-low and cook for 5 to 7 minutes, tossing occasionally, until the tomatoes begin to soften but don't break up.
While the tomatoes are cooking, add the capellini to the pot of boiling water and cook for 2 minutes, or according to the directions on the package. Drain the pasta, reserving some of the pasta water.
Place the pasta in a large serving bowl, add the tomatoes and Parmesan and toss well. Add some of the pasta water if the pasta seems too dry. Serve large bowls of pasta with extra basil sprinkled on top and a big bowl of extra Parmesan on the side.
